#ifndef HARDWARE_SAM_BOARD_H
#define HARDWARE_SAM_BOARD_H
/**
* Board pin values are constructed from port control register index
* and pin bit position.
* @param[in] index control register index.
* @param[in] pin pin bit position in control register.
*/
#define GPIO_PIN(index,pin) (((index) << 8) | (pin))
/**
* Return port control register index from board pin value.
* @return io port address
*/
#define GPIO_REG(pin) ((pin) >> 8)
/**
* Return pin mask from board pin value.
* @return pin mask
*/
#define GPIO_MASK(pin) (1U << ((pin) & 0xff))
#if defined(__SAM3X8E__)
/**
* GPIO digital pin symbols for SAM3X8E based boards.
* @section Board
* @code
* Arduino Due
* ----- -------
* +-|(o)|--------------------| USB |---+
* | | | | | |
* | ----- | | |
* | ------- |
* | |
* | []| SCL
* | []| SDA
* | []| AREF
* | []| GND
* NC |[] []| D13
* IOREF |[] []| D12
* RESET |[] []| D11
* 3V3 |[] []| D10
* 5V |[] []| D9
* GND |[] []| D8
* GND |[] |
* Vin |[] []| D7
* | []| D6
* A0 |[] []| D5
* A1 |[] []| D4
* A2 |[] []| D3
* A3 |[] []| D2
* A4 |[] ICSP []| D1
* A5 |[] [o-o-*] []| D0
* A6 |[] [o-o-o] |
* A7 |[] []| D14
* | []| D15
* A8 |[] []| D16
* A9 |[] []| D17
* A10 |[] []| D18
* A11 |[] []| D19
* A12 |[] []| D20
* A13 |[] []| D21
* A14 |[] |
* A15 |[]52 30 22 |
* GND |[][][][][][][][][][][][][][][][][][]| 5V
* GND |[][][][][][][][][][][][][][][][][][]| 5V
* \ 53 31 /
* +------------------------+
* @endcode
*/
class BOARD {
public:
enum pin_t {
D0 = GPIO_PIN(0,8), //!<PIOA:8/RX
D1 = GPIO_PIN(0,9), //!<PIOA:9/TX
D2 = GPIO_PIN(1,25), //!<PIOB:25
D3 = GPIO_PIN(2,28), //!<PIOC:28
D4 = GPIO_PIN(2,26), //!<PIOC:26
D5 = GPIO_PIN(2,25), //!<PIOC:25
D6 = GPIO_PIN(2,24), //!<PIOC:24
D7 = GPIO_PIN(2,23), //!<PIOC:23
D8 = GPIO_PIN(2,22), //!<PIOC:22
D9 = GPIO_PIN(2,21), //!<PIOC:21
D10 = GPIO_PIN(2,29), //!<PIOC:29
D11 = GPIO_PIN(3,7), //!<PIOD:7
D12 = GPIO_PIN(3,8), //!<PIOD:8
D13 = GPIO_PIN(1,27), //!<PIOB:27
D14 = GPIO_PIN(3,4), //!<PIOD:4
D15 = GPIO_PIN(3,5), //!<PIOD:5
D16 = GPIO_PIN(0,13), //!<PIOA:13
D17 = GPIO_PIN(0,12), //!<PIOA:12
D18 = GPIO_PIN(0,11), //!<PIOA:11
D19 = GPIO_PIN(0,10), //!<PIOA:10
D20 = GPIO_PIN(1,12), //!<PIOB:12
D21 = GPIO_PIN(1,13), //!<PIOB:13
D22 = GPIO_PIN(1,26), //!<PIOB:26
D23 = GPIO_PIN(0,14), //!<PIOA:14
D24 = GPIO_PIN(0,15), //!<PIOA:16
D25 = GPIO_PIN(3,0), //!<PIOD:0
D26 = GPIO_PIN(3,1), //!<PIOD:1
D27 = GPIO_PIN(3,2), //!<PIOD:2
D28 = GPIO_PIN(3,3), //!<PIOD:3
D29 = GPIO_PIN(3,6), //!<PIOD:6
D30 = GPIO_PIN(3,9), //!<PIOD:9
D31 = GPIO_PIN(0,7), //!<PIOA:7
D32 = GPIO_PIN(3,10), //!<PIOD:10
D33 = GPIO_PIN(2,1), //!<PIOC:1
D34 = GPIO_PIN(2,2), //!<PIOC:2
D35 = GPIO_PIN(2,3), //!<PIOC:3
D36 = GPIO_PIN(2,4), //!<PIOC:4
D37 = GPIO_PIN(2,5), //!<PIOC:5
D38 = GPIO_PIN(2,6), //!<PIOC:6
D39 = GPIO_PIN(2,7), //!<PIOC:7
D40 = GPIO_PIN(2,8), //!<PIOC:8
D41 = GPIO_PIN(2,9), //!<PIOC:9
D42 = GPIO_PIN(0,19), //!<PIOA:19
D43 = GPIO_PIN(0,20), //!<PIOA:20
D44 = GPIO_PIN(2,19), //!<PIOC:19
D45 = GPIO_PIN(2,18), //!<PIOC:18
D46 = GPIO_PIN(2,17), //!<PIOC:17
D47 = GPIO_PIN(2,16), //!<PIOC:16
D48 = GPIO_PIN(2,15), //!<PIOC:15
D49 = GPIO_PIN(2,14), //!<PIOC:14
D50 = GPIO_PIN(2,13), //!<PIOC:13
D51 = GPIO_PIN(2,12), //!<PIOC:12
D52 = GPIO_PIN(1,21), //!<PIOB:21
D53 = GPIO_PIN(1,14) //!<PIOB:14
};
};
#else
#error Board.h: sam mcu not supported
#endif
#endif
